Output 8890cf4028ae80df0d0c80fead8473253cd346b5502809292469d5420094de8a:3

value
1592000
script pubkey
OP_0 OP_PUSHBYTES_20 880f3b6448f53bd6b9994cccf014464ecc2a25b7
address
bc1q3q8nkezg75aadwvefnx0q9zxfmxz5fdh28uxsw
transaction
8890cf4028ae80df0d0c80fead8473253cd346b5502809292469d5420094de8a
confirmations
178228
spent
true